Design Flood Calculation Method of Micro-Watershed in Chongqing

Based on the survey and evaluation results of torrential flood calamity in Chongqing from 2013 to 2017, the concept of micro-watershed in Chongqing and the calculation method of design flood for areas without hydrological data are proposed. By comprehensively overlaying each element layer, clustering the categories and integrating the fragments, six divisions of design flood for micro-watersheds in Chongqing are confirmed. A complete set of atlas and empirical formulas for the design flood calculation of the “six divisions and five frequencies of flood” covering the entire micro-watersheds of Chongqing is formed by carrying out the design flood calculation and correction and the flood survey data is used to verify the calculation results, which can be used in the ungauged micro-watersheds and completes and subdivides the results of the design flood in Chongqing areas.
